Responsibilities
- Support new and existing clients with their data engineering requirements as part of a dedicated team.
- Advise clients on optimal technical approaches to meet their business objectives.
- Manage and monitor progress across multiple client engagements, ensuring timely tracking and reporting.
- Develop, deploy, and maintain sophisticated data pipelines, fix data issues, implement transformations, and suggest improvements for data quality and integrity.
- Evaluate data sources for relevance and propose which datasets should be integrated into analytics workflows.
- Apply foundational data management principles such as data governance, security protocols, and quality assurance in all solutions.
- Work closely with internal and cross-functional teams to deliver data products and train end users on analytical tools and environments.
- Investigate, diagnose, and resolve data-related defects and system incidents of moderate complexity.
- Validate the accuracy and reliability of data flows, transformation logic, and data components through rigorous testing.
Requirements
- Minimum of five years of hands-on experience in data engineering or data modeling, ideally with direct work on the Databricks platform.
- Proficiency with one or more technologies such as Spark, Hadoop, Kafka, Databricks, pandas, scikit-learn, HPO, or data warehousing systems like SQL and OLTP/OLAP/DSS.
- Demonstrated expertise in data modeling, including dimensional modeling and either Data Vault or third normal form, especially when working with disorganized source data.
- Solid grasp of the complete data analytics lifecycle from ingestion to insight.
- Proven ability to troubleshoot and solve technical problems, including debugging code and data workflows.
- Clear and effective communication skills, both spoken and written.
- Intermediate leadership capabilities with a history of self-driven learning and development.
- Strong organizational skills with the ability to manage time and prioritize tasks efficiently.
Nice to Have
- Experience in data engineering or machine learning operations is highly advantageous.
- Familiarity with public cloud infrastructure such as AWS, Azure, or Google Cloud Platform is beneficial.
- Industry background in Financial Services, particularly within banking, is preferred.
- Knowledge of regulatory compliance standards and requirements in banking IT environments.
- Databricks Certification is a nice-to-have credential.
